Meatloaf Recipe with Oatmeal 

This Meatloaf Recipe with Oatmeal uses ground beef blended with diced onion, quick oats, milk, eggs, Worcestershire sauce, and seasonings. Baked with a ketchup glaze, it forms a moist, firm loaf with a balanced savory flavor enhanced by the oatmeal as a binder.

Description

Meatloaf with oatmeal combines 85% lean ground beef and finely diced onion with quick oats and whole milk to help bind and retain moisture throughout baking. Eggs and Worcestershire sauce add richness and depth, while salt and garlic powder provide seasoning. The mixture rests for 10 minutes before shaping into a loaf, allowing flavors to meld.

The loaf is coated with ketchup before baking at 375°F for 45 minutes or until it reaches a safe internal temperature of 165°F, resulting in a tender yet sliceable texture. Letting the meatloaf rest before slicing helps the juices redistribute and maintain moistness.

This straightforward meatloaf suits comfort food meals and pairs well with mashed potatoes or steamed vegetables. The oatmeal helps keep the meatloaf from drying out, making it forgiving for home cooks.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 2 lb ground beef 85% lean or leaner
  • 1 onion diced, small
  • 3/4 cup quick oats uncooked
  • 1/2 cup milk whole
  • 2 egg large
  • 2 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tsp salt sea salt
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 cup ketchup

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ine all the ingredients together except for the ketchup. Allow the mixture to rest for 10 minutes at room temperature to meld the flavors together.
  2. Line a loaf pan or baking sheet with foil. Transfer the meat mixture into the pan with your hands, shaping it into a loaf.
  3. Spread the ketchup over the loaf and bake it at 375°F for 45 minutes, or until internal temperature reaches 165°F.
  4. Remove the meatloaf from the pan and allow it to rest for 10 minutes before slicing into it. Enjoy!
